|
59 | 59 | </Midl> |
60 | 60 | <ClCompile> |
61 | 61 | <Optimization>Disabled</Optimization> |
62 | | - <AdditionalIncludeDirectories>%I_MPI_ROOT%\intel64\include;$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_c;$(ProjectDir)\..\..\src_cpp\helpers;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
| 62 | + <AdditionalIncludeDirectories Condition="'$(I_MPI_ROOT)' != ''">%I_MPI_ROOT%\intel64\include;$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_c;$(ProjectDir)\..\..\src_cpp\helpers;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
| 63 | + <AdditionalIncludeDirectories Condition="'$(I_MPI_ROOT)' == ''">$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_c;$(ProjectDir)\..\..\src_cpp\helpers;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
63 | 64 | <PreprocessorDefinitions>WIN32;_DEBUG;_CONSOLE;WIN_IMB;_CRT_SECURE_NO_DEPRECATE;_SCL_SECURE_NO_WARNINGS;MPI1;%(PreprocessorDefinitions)</PreprocessorDefinitions> |
64 | 65 | <MinimalRebuild>true</MinimalRebuild> |
65 | 66 | <BasicRuntimeChecks>EnableFastChecks</BasicRuntimeChecks> |
|
70 | 71 | <DebugInformationFormat>ProgramDatabase</DebugInformationFormat> |
71 | 72 | </ClCompile> |
72 | 73 | <Link> |
73 | | - <AdditionalDependencies>%I_MPI_ROOT%\intel64\lib\debug\impi.lib;%(AdditionalDependencies)</AdditionalDependencies> |
| 74 | + <AdditionalDependencies Condition="'$(I_MPI_ROOT)' != ''">%I_MPI_ROOT%\intel64\lib\debug\impi.lib;%(AdditionalDependencies)</AdditionalDependencies> |
| 75 | + <AdditionalDependencies Condition="'$(I_MPI_ROOT)' == ''">%(AdditionalDependencies)</AdditionalDependencies> |
74 | 76 | <GenerateDebugInformation>true</GenerateDebugInformation> |
75 | 77 | <SubSystem>Console</SubSystem> |
76 | 78 | <TargetMachine>MachineX64</TargetMachine> |
|
83 | 85 | <ClCompile> |
84 | 86 | <Optimization>MaxSpeed</Optimization> |
85 | 87 | <IntrinsicFunctions>true</IntrinsicFunctions> |
86 | | - <AdditionalIncludeDirectories>%I_MPI_ROOT%\intel64\include;$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_cpp\helpers;$(ProjectDir)\..\..\src_c;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
| 88 | + <AdditionalIncludeDirectories Condition="'$(I_MPI_ROOT)' != ''">%I_MPI_ROOT%\intel64\include;$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_cpp\helpers;$(ProjectDir)\..\..\src_c;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
| 89 | + <AdditionalIncludeDirectories Condition="'$(I_MPI_ROOT)' == ''">$(ProjectDir)\..\..\src_cpp;$(ProjectDir)\..\..\src_cpp\helpers;$(ProjectDir)\..\..\src_c;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ories> |
87 | 90 | <PreprocessorDefinitions>WIN32;NDEBUG;_CONSOLE;WIN_IMB;_CRT_SECURE_NO_DEPRECATE;_SCL_SECURE_NO_WARNINGS;MPI1;%(PreprocessorDefinitions)</PreprocessorDefinitions> |
88 | 91 | <RuntimeLibrary>MultiThreaded</RuntimeLibrary> |
89 | 92 | <FunctionLevelLinking>true</FunctionLevelLinking> |
|
93 | 96 | <DebugInformationFormat>ProgramDatabase</DebugInformationFormat> |
94 | 97 | </ClCompile> |
95 | 98 | <Link> |
96 | | - <AdditionalDependencies>%I_MPI_ROOT%\intel64\lib\release\impi.lib;%(AdditionalDependencies)</AdditionalDependencies> |
| 99 | + <AdditionalDependencies Condition="'$(I_MPI_ROOT)' != ''">%I_MPI_ROOT%\intel64\lib\release\impi.lib;%(AdditionalDependencies)</AdditionalDependencies> |
| 100 | + <AdditionalDependencies Condition="'$(I_MPI_ROOT)' == ''">%(AdditionalDependencies)</AdditionalDependencies> |
97 | 101 | <GenerateDebugInformation>true</GenerateDebugInformation> |
98 | 102 | <SubSystem>Console</SubSystem> |
99 | 103 | <OptimizeReferences>true</OptimizeReferences> |
|
0 commit comments